About the Elmore County market
What is the median home price in Elmore County, AL?
The median sale price in Elmore County, AL is $256,333 (data through July 2026), based on deeds recorded with the county. That is up 1.5% from a year earlier.
How many homes sell in Elmore County, AL each year?
1,239 homes sold in Elmore County, AL over the last 12 months (data through July 2026). TopHap counts recorded arm's-length deeds, not listings, so the figure is not affected by which brokerage handled the sale.
Is Elmore County, AL a buyer's or seller's market?
Elmore County, AL is currently a seller's market, scoring 65 out of 100 on TopHap's market temperature index (data through July 2026). The score weighs sales velocity and price direction; above 60 favours sellers, below 40 favours buyers.
How many homes are there in Elmore County, AL?
Elmore County, AL contains 31,075 residential properties, with a median of 1,794 square feet, 4 bedrooms, built around 1995. The median TopHap Estimate is $273K.
How does Elmore County, AL compare to the rest of Alabama?
By median home value, Elmore County, AL is the 9th most expensive of 67 counties in Alabama. Its typical home is worth more than 60% of all homes in Alabama. Tuscaloosa County ranks just above it and Cullman County just below. The ranking is rebuilt nightly from the county assessor record of every home in each area.
Do people own or rent in Elmore County, AL?
78% of homes in Elmore County, AL are owner-occupied. 8% are held by a company rather than an individual.
How much equity do owners in Elmore County, AL hold?
58% of mortgaged homes in Elmore County, AL are equity-rich, meaning the loan balance is under half the home's value. 1.5% owe more than the home is worth.
